Friends at Court

GLEANINGS FOR NEXT WEEK'S CALENDAR March 30, Sunday.—Low Sunday. - ~ 31, Monday.—Annunciation of the Blessed Virgin Mary (March 25). April 1, Tuesday.—St. Patrick, Bishop and Confessor, and Patron of Ireland (March 17). ~ 2, Wednesday.St. Joseph, Spouse of the Blessed Virgin Mary. (March 19). < j, 3, Thursday. — Of the Feria. ~ 4, Friday.—St. Isidore, Bishop, Confessor, and Doctor. ~ 5, Saturday. — St. Vincent Ferrer, Confessor. Low Sunday. This Sunday is styled in liturgical language Dominica in Albis, or Sunday in White, because in olden times the neophytes, whom it was customary to baptise on Holy Saturday, wore their white robes for the last time to-day. The Annunciation of the Blessed Virgin Mary. ' The Angel Gabriel was sent from God into a city of Galilee called Nazareth, to a virgin espoused to a man whose name was Joseph, and, the virgin's name was Mary. . . . And the angel said to her: "Fear not, Mary, for thou hast found grace with God. Behold, thou shalt conceive in thy womb, and shalt bring forth a Son, and thou shalt call His name Jesus" ' (Gospel t of St Luke.) GRAINS OF GOLD AVE MARIA. Hail, virgin mother of a King Whose throne thou art; Chaste daughter of thy Son divine Whose Sacred Heart Its precious life blood drew from thee, Hail, full of grace ! Hail, mother of the Lord, Who is with thee, Plant courage in this heart of mine, O pray for me; God's angel's word I bring to thee, Hail, full of grace ! Rev. Henry B. Tierney. A conscience without God is a tribunal without a judge. . Carry on every enterprise as if all depended on the success of it. Learning by study must be won; 'twas ne'er entailed from son to son. Let us make haste to live, since every day to a wise man is a new life. Nothing was ever so unfamiliar and startling to a man as his own thoughts. If you act ungratefully you are doing an injury to all who are in need. There are no blockheads in Nature. For them, we are indebted to society. The certain way to be cheated is to fancy oneself more cunning than others. Patience is the student's great virtue; it is the mark of the best quality of mind. The act we may perform does not sanctify us so much as the spirit in which we perform it. If you boast a lot about your distinguished forbears you cannot be living up to their standard. Perhaps no man ever practised all he preached, but this is not a final argument against preaching.
